The Sanctuary of the Heart

Teachings from Namo Amituofo, recorded by the Buddha's disciple, Shi Haize. On the fifteenth day of January, two thousand and twenty-three, during the , these words were shared to guide all practitioners on their journey toward .

For those who have already set aside the dust of the mundane world to enter the Buddha’s gate, you have done so for many profound reasons. You are seeking the Truth, or perhaps you wish to heal your body and soothe your weary heart. You may be striving to find your true self, hoping to no longer wander in search of a place for your heart to rely upon. You wish to no longer be shaken in your pursuit of the and your quest to rediscover your true self by the changes in external environments, slander, or adversity.

You hope to be self-mastered, no longer suffering from the manifestation of karma as come to seek revenge and repay grievances. This is entirely possible because the Buddha is present; the Buddha is the eternal refuge for all. Although you, as a child of the Buddha, may suffer because you do not listen to the Buddha’s words, choosing instead to follow the sensations of your physical body and the manifestation of the karma of old age and illness, there is a way to liberation.

If you, as a child, are willing to listen to the Buddha’s words and no longer listen to the sensations of the physical body, you will find peace. You must come to know the impermanence of old age and illness, know the various sufferings of the laws of karma and cause and effect and reincarnation, and know that the sins of the past can rival Mount Sumeru and be as deep as the great ocean. By truly repenting and changing your ways, you will find the path forward.

The Eternal Embrace of the Buddha

The Buddha will not abandon you or reject you; please, child, set your heart at ease. The Buddha is always waiting with outstretched hands for you to return—at the Hsiang Kuang Buddhist Centre, within the hearts of all children, and in every single recitation of the Buddha-name, Namo Amituofo. When you chant with a sincere heart, you are connecting directly with the infinite of the Buddha. Trust in this connection, for it is the bridge that will lead you home to the Western Pure Land of Ultimate Bliss.
